An army veteran, a longtime mayor and a teacher are among the five candidates seeking to represent the 48th Assembly District in California's primary election next month.
Running to succeed Assemblyman Roger Hernandez are four Democrats -- Bassett Unified School District Board member Armando Barajas, Baldwin Park Mayor Manuel Lozano, Baldwin Park Unified School District Board member Blanca Rubio and Upper San Gabriel Valley Municipal Water District Board member Bryan Urias -- and Republican Cory Ellenson, a self-employed tax attorney and Glendora Unified School District board member.
